I upgraded my controller and pre-downloaded the image to all of the AP's for a later reboot. When I try to reboot the controller I get the following message.
AP software being upgraded, please try again later
All AP's show the image has been pre-downloaded
I need some suggestions on how to reboot the Controller, with out actually powering the Controller off and back on

You can check, using CLI, if all of your APs have complete pre-downloading using the command "sh ap image all". On the first page, make sure the "Total Number of APs" value is correct and the next five lines below this is "0". If not, you should see (in the next subsequent pages) which APs haven't finished the predownloading.
In the meantime, enter this command "reset system FORCED" to force the controller to reboot.
